Research on Flip Bucket Shape in Spillway of a Hydropower Station
A hydropower station is located in a high mountain canyon area,the discharge structure is arranged on the right bank,and the downstream river channel of the spillway outlet is very narrow.The energy dissipation design of the outlet should fully consider the impact on the downstream bank slope and avoid the top rushing to the opposite bank.Therefore,it is necessary to focus on the study of the flip bucket shape.Through the hydraulic model test,combined with the engineering characteristics,the buckets of different shapes are analyzed,and the four-slit differential flip bucket shape is finally recommended.The results show that the flow pattern of the four-slit differential flip bucket is better under various working conditions;The water tongue is pulled apart longitudinally and the falling point is in the middle of the river,which has little influence on the slope of both banks and can meet the requirements of safe operation of the project.The research results can provide reference for the energy dissipation design of spillway in narrow riverbed.
